AI-generated tattoo project concept featuring a moonlit wolf in a dense forest, mirrored by a tranquil lake. Rendered in black and grey, the composition relies on controlled shading and negative space to achieve depth and legibility on skin. The central wolf stands at the forest’s edge, its fur textured with fine line work that preserves clarity in both large back pieces and smaller placements. Behind, the silhouettes of pine trees rise against a luminous moon, whose glow is echoed in the water to form a circular focal point. At the water’s edge, exposed roots weave into the foreground, creating a natural frame and a grounding anchor for the scene. The artwork employs a layered grayscale approach: solid blacks shape the tree trunks and shoreline, midtones build the fur and water ripples, and selective highlights emphasize the moon and its reflection. Such balance ensures the design remains striking from a distance and readable up close, which is essential for a successful tattoo design. Symbolically, the wolf conveys guardianship and resilience; the moon represents cycles and mystery; the forest and lake allude to solitude, reflection, and the journey through darkness into light. The piece is well suited to a cover-up because the heavy shadows can mask existing ink while the new silhouette maintains strong contrast.
